Samsara Inc. delivered Q4 2025 revenue of $346.3 million, reflecting a 25% year-over-year increase. The company’s Annual Recurring Revenue (ARR) grew to $1.46 billion, a 32% increase. Samsara reported a GAAP operating loss of $18.4 million, significantly improved from the prior year's $123.0 million loss. Non-GAAP EPS reached $0.11, compared to $0.04 in Q4 2024. The company achieved an adjusted free cash flow of $48.5 million, indicating a positive cash generation trend.

Samsara expects continued growth momentum in fiscal 2026, with projected Q1 revenue between $350 million and $352 million, and full-year revenue guidance of $1.52 billion to $1.53 billion. The company aims for a non-GAAP operating margin of 11% for the full fiscal year.
